What Is Sodium Percarbonate?
Sodium percarbonate is a solid compound made by combining sodium carbonate with hydrogen peroxide. It is generally available in a white granular or powder form.
One of its main advantages is its ability to release hydrogen peroxide when it comes into contact with water. This gives it bleaching and cleaning properties without relying on traditional chlorine-based bleaching agents.
Sodium percarbonate is widely used in laundry detergents, stain removers, dishwasher detergents, household cleaning products, industrial cleaners, and some water treatment applications.
It is also valued for its relatively convenient handling and its ability to provide oxygen-based cleaning performance.
Because of these applications, demand for sodium percarbonate is closely linked to the growth of the detergent and cleaning products markets.

Factors That Influence Sodium Percarbonate Prices
There are several factors that can affect sodium percarbonate prices. These factors often work together, which means the market can sometimes move quickly.
Raw Material Costs
The cost of raw materials is one of the most important factors.
Sodium percarbonate production depends on materials such as sodium carbonate and hydrogen peroxide. Changes in the cost or availability of these inputs can affect manufacturing expenses.
When raw material costs rise, producers may face higher operating costs. This can eventually place upward pressure on sodium percarbonate prices.
When raw material supply is comfortable and input costs are lower, manufacturers may have more flexibility in pricing.
Hydrogen Peroxide Costs
Hydrogen peroxide is an important component in sodium percarbonate production.
Changes in hydrogen peroxide prices can therefore have a direct impact on production economics. Energy costs, manufacturing capacity, feedstock availability, and regional supply conditions can all influence hydrogen peroxide prices.
When hydrogen peroxide becomes more expensive, sodium percarbonate producers may need to adjust their selling prices.
Demand from Detergent Manufacturers
Detergent manufacturing is one of the most important sources of sodium percarbonate demand.
It is used in laundry products, stain removers, dishwasher powders, and other cleaning formulations.
When detergent production increases, manufacturers generally require more sodium percarbonate. Strong demand can support firm market prices, particularly when supply is not expanding at the same pace.
Household Cleaning Demand
Consumer demand for household cleaning products also affects the market.
People use cleaning products throughout the year, but demand can change based on seasonal patterns, consumer spending, hygiene awareness, and broader economic conditions.
Growing demand for oxygen-based cleaning products can support sodium percarbonate consumption.
Industrial Cleaning Applications
Sodium percarbonate is also used in industrial cleaning applications.
Factories, commercial facilities, hospitality businesses, and other organizations require cleaning products for routine maintenance and sanitation.
Growth in industrial activity can therefore create additional demand for cleaning chemicals.
Energy and Production Costs
Manufacturing sodium percarbonate requires energy, equipment, labor, water, packaging, and quality control.
Electricity and other energy costs can have a meaningful impact on overall production expenses.
If energy prices rise significantly, manufacturers may face higher operating costs. These costs can eventually influence the market price of the finished product.
Transportation and Logistics
Transportation is another important part of the final cost.
Sodium percarbonate is shipped between manufacturing locations, warehouses, distributors, and customers. Fuel prices, freight rates, storage costs, container availability, and port conditions can affect delivered prices.
A disruption in logistics can sometimes create regional supply tightness and temporary price increases.
